Originally posted by Maestro View PostMoving the arm down without moving the pivot would still change the camber curve, won't it?
Or is the difference negligible/not worth the effort?
Leave a comment:
-
the only reason it changes the camber/toe curves is because you're lengthening the arm by a tiny fraction.
Assume the stock arm is 12" long and the spacer thingy is 2" long.
adding the spacer before the pivot just makes the arm 12.16" long now.Attached Files

Originally posted by Def View PostYou want to move the PIVOT location down in relation to the ball joint mounting location. So you want a longer shank length. Just moving the whole housing up and down does absolutely NOTHING to suspension geometry.
